The purpose of the post is to praise our local veterinarian, Rocio. We had a crisis with our dog, Mikey, on Monday and were frantic to find help for him. My first call was to Julie, who we all know is the saint to all animals here. She immediately hooked me up with Rocio, who came to our house with her medicine bag in hand. Rocio sat in our yard for two and a half hours with Mikey, administering medicine and monitoring him. She would not leave until she was comfortable that he would be ok. I honestly believe she saved his life. I do not think he could have survived another hour. She gave us her numbers and insisted we should call day or night. The good news is that we think Mikey will be ok, we have medicine coming from AK tomorrow with Jessica. Once he begins that, he should be fine.

The point of all this is to impress on everyone the importance of supporting this lady in our town. Rocio is amazingly compassionate, and very capable. I had not given much thought to the fact that we had a vet in town since all of Mikey’s check-ups, etc, are done in AK before we travel with him. But “you never know”, and having someone available in 5 minutes rather than traveling to Melaque with a sick,or injured, animal is a luxury we should not take for granted. She is depending on this town for her living, so if you have a need for a Vet, consider using her instead of making the trip to another vet. Being supportive of Cisco’s Amigos also benefits Rocio, as they help with all sorts of health issues in animals here.

Thank you Julie, and Rocio…..Mikey is smiling again!
